Import Using CSV
Using a CSV file for item import can be a fast and simple way to update your inventory. Nevertheless, you need to make certain the file includes the appropriate product images. Likewise, it’s a great concept to backup your data before making any modifications.
The CSV file can be edited by a spreadsheet editor. You can delete, change, or re-import the file. However, you need to erase any e-mail addresses or contact number that appear in the CSV file.
The CSV file should be in UTF-8 format. This is a needed format to import to Shopify. Importing a CSV file that does not contain UTF-8 characters can cause inaccurate characters to appear.
The Collection column can be contributed to the CSV file. The Collection column is utilized to organize products into collections. If a Collection does not exist, Shopify will produce one for you. Nevertheless, you can leave the Collection column blank.
For each item you add to your store, you can amount to 250 images. Each image needs to be published to an openly available URL. If you ‘d like to use a gift card, you can edit the details in the Gift card column.

3D Secure Checkouts
Including 3D Secure to your checkout can give your customers an additional layer of security while you’re processing their payment. It also minimizes scams, ensuring your customers’ payments are safe.
Adding 3D Secure to your checkout is easy to do with Shopify. Just go to your Shopify Settings page and pick 3D Secure, then click “Add 3D Secure.” Shopify will process your charge card deals through 3D Secure.
Shopify’s 3D Secure is an additional layer of security, ensuring your client’s payment is safe. Shopify will not charge your client if they stop working to pass the authentication difficulty.
When you include 3D Secure to your checkout, your client will get a notice that they need to enter their security code. They will then be rerouted to a protected page from the card company’s site. Depending upon the type of card used, the customer will be asked to enter a password or passcode.
